Understanding Women’s Boxers: What Makes Them Different

Women’s boxers are no longer just a relaxed alternative to briefs; they are engineered garments designed around comfort, movement. modern lifestyles. Unlike traditional men’s boxers, women’s boxers focus on a contoured yet flexible fit, softer waistbands. fabrics that adapt to the body without riding up. Key terms explained:
  • Breathable fabrics
  • Materials like cotton-modal blends or bamboo that allow airflow and reduce moisture buildup.
  • Four-way stretch
  • Fabric technology that stretches in multiple directions, ensuring freedom of movement.
  • Tagless construction
  • Eliminates stitched labels to prevent skin irritation.
According to the Textile Exchange, softer natural and semi-synthetic fibers such as modal and bamboo are increasingly preferred in intimate apparel due to their skin-friendly and sustainable properties. These qualities are foundational when evaluating the top 10 best boxers for women.

Why Fabric Choice Matters for Everyday Comfort

Fabric selection directly impacts comfort, durability. skin health. Dermatologists from the American Academy of Dermatology often recommend breathable, moisture-wicking underwear to reduce friction and irritation. Common fabrics used in high-quality women’s boxers include:
  • Cotton
  • Natural, breathable. ideal for daily wear.
  • Modal
  • Derived from beechwood, known for its silky softness and resistance to shrinkage.
  • Bamboo blends
  • Naturally antibacterial and excellent for sensitive skin.
  • Elastane (Spandex)
  • Adds stretch and shape retention.
In real-world testing during long workdays and overnight wear, modal-cotton blends consistently outperform pure cotton in maintaining softness after multiple washes.

Flexible Fit Explained: Waistbands, Seams. Mobility

A flexible fit is not just about stretch; it’s about intelligent construction. High-quality women’s boxers use:
  • Wide, soft waistbands that don’t dig into the skin
  • Flatlock seams to minimize chafing
  • Mid-rise or high-rise cuts for better coverage

FAQs

What makes boxers for women different from regular underwear?

Women’s boxers are designed with a more flexible fit around the hips and thighs, often using softer fabrics and smoother seams to avoid digging in or riding up.

Are women’s boxers actually comfortable for all-day wear?

Yes, when made from breathable and stretchy materials, boxers can feel lightweight and relaxed enough for lounging, sleeping, or even wearing under loose clothing.

Which fabrics feel the softest in women’s boxers?

Modal, bamboo, cotton blends. microfiber are popular for their smooth feel, breathability. ability to move with the body without stiffness.

Do boxers for women ride up or bunch during movement?

A good pair with a flexible waistband and well-cut leg openings should stay in place, even when walking or sitting for long periods.

Can women’s boxers be worn for sleeping?

Absolutely. Many women prefer boxers for sleep because they offer more coverage, airflow. a relaxed fit compared to tighter underwear styles.

How should women’s boxers fit around the waist and legs?

They should sit comfortably at the waist without squeezing. the legs should feel loose but not baggy, allowing natural movement without friction.

Are women’s boxers suitable for warmer weather?

Yes, especially when made from breathable, moisture-wicking fabrics that help keep the skin cool and dry during hot or humid conditions.
